At Petticoat-Schmitt, you’ll oversee heavy civil construction projects — including site development, grading, storm drainage, water, sewer, utilities, and earthwork — from planning to execution, leading teams that build infrastructure transforming communities across Northeast Florida. What You’ll Do
Field Leadership
Lead and manage all field operations for assigned site development and utility projects. Supervise foremen, direct crews, coordinate subcontractors, and ensure efficient use of Petticoat-Schmitt resources. Maintain full knowledge of project plans, specifications, contracts, schedules, budgets, and change directives. Maintain accurate weekly “hard” short-term schedules and proactively manage upcoming work. Drive production and maintain project timelines —
you control the schedule, not the other way around. Safety & Quality Management
Act as the on-site safety leader and enforce all Petticoat-Schmitt and OSHA rules. Conduct Job Briefings daily and ensure foremen do the same. Maintain clean, organized, and environmentally compliant job sites. Hold crews and subcontractors accountable to Petticoat-Schmitt’s quality standards. Project Coordination & Documentation
Ensure all reporting and documentation is timely and accurate, including daily reports, timesheets, schedules, production reports, locates, environmental logs, and change order information. Communicate consistently with project managers and senior management. Support monthly cost forecasting, budget reviews, and project meetings. Team Development
Mentor, coach, and grow foremen, operators, and laborers. Assist with evaluating performance, hiring, and training upcoming leaders. Champion Petticoat-Schmitt’s people-first culture and A.C.T. values. What We’re Looking For
Skills & Abilities
Effective communication and leadership skills. Ability to read plans, measure, calculate quantities, and perform construction math. Ability to use levels, lasers, and total stations. Working knowledge of PSCC and OSHA safety requirements. Tech-comfortable — able to use tablets, smartphones, and digital reporting tools. Understanding of equipment capabilities and safe operations. Physical Requirements
Ability to stand or sit for long periods, climb in/out of equipment, and lift up to 40 lbs. Ability to distinguish jobsite sounds such as backup alarms and verbal cues. Ability to work outdoors in all weather conditions. Training & Experience
3+
of civil construction leadership as a crew lead, foreman, or superintendent. Experience in
site development, utilities, grading, and/or public works
required. High school diploma or equivalent. Training such as Competent Person, Confined Space, Rigging, Fall Protection, and NPDES/Erosion Control preferred. Why Petticoat-Schmitt?
